THE LAP RECORD
- THE LAP -
Lake Windermere Ultra Marathon


 

THE LAP was created to provide a gateway event for runners and walkers to step up to ULTRA distance, without the worry of navigation, food or exposure to really bad weather.

With 5 fully stocked feed stations and a low level Lake District route, you are already on the bad weather option.

A beautiful 75K/47 mile, fully
signposted trail ultra marathon,  following some of the most stunning, runnable and best way-marked trails in The Lake District.
 
• Open to both runners and walkers • 1,600 route marking arrows • GPS Tracker • Route Map • GPX • 5 fully stocked feed stations • 1 half way, bag drop aid station  • Finishers meal  • Stunning Finishers Medal made locally of wood.

You have 24 hours to take in all the best viewpoints as you circumnavigate England's largest and most iconic lake.
